Storms moving through northwest Florida yesterday produced a small waterspout off Panama City Beach in the Gulf. The water spout stayed offshore and did not cause any problems. The National Weather Service in Tallahassee said several waterspouts were reported Monday morning and afternoon off the coast of the Panhandle and off Inlet Beach around the same time. Waterspouts can pose a danger to boaters who should be alert to dangerous weather conditions.
